Understanding The Costs Associated With Asset Protection Trusts
Asset protection trusts are an increasingly popular estate planning tool designed to safeguard your assets from creditors, legal judgments, and other potential threats While the benefits of setting up an asset protection trust are clear, many individuals are concerned about the associated costs In this article, we will explore the various expenses associated with establishing and maintaining an asset protection trust, as well as provide some tips on how to keep costs down.
The cost of setting up an asset protection trust can vary significantly depending on several factors, including the complexity of the trust, the jurisdiction in which it is established, and the attorney or financial advisor you choose to work with In general, you can expect to pay anywhere from a few thousand dollars to tens of thousands of dollars to set up an asset protection trust.
One of the primary costs associated with establishing an asset protection trust is the fee charged by the attorney or financial advisor who helps you create the trust These professionals have specialized knowledge and expertise in setting up trusts and ensuring that they comply with all relevant laws and regulations Depending on the complexity of your trust and the reputation of the professional you choose to work with, you may pay anywhere from $1,000 to $10,000 or more for their services.
In addition to the initial set up costs, there are ongoing fees associated with maintaining an asset protection trust These can include annual trustee fees, legal fees for making changes to the trust or ensuring compliance with changing laws, and administrative costs for tasks such as record keeping and tax preparation These fees can add up over time, so it’s important to factor them into your overall budget when considering whether to establish an asset protection trust.
Another potential cost associated with asset protection trusts is the filing and registration fees required by the jurisdiction in which the trust is established These fees can vary depending on the location and can range from a few hundred dollars to several thousand dollars It’s important to research these fees in advance and factor them into your overall budget when planning to establish an asset protection trust.

One option is to consider setting up a trust in a jurisdiction with lower filing and registration fees Some states have more favorable trust laws than others, which can result in lower costs for establishing and maintaining a trust.
Another way to save money on an asset protection trust is to carefully consider the complexity of the trust itself While some individuals may require a highly complex trust with multiple layers of protection, others may be able to achieve their goals with a simpler, less expensive trust structure By working closely with your attorney or financial advisor to clearly define your goals and objectives, you can ensure that your trust is structured in the most cost-effective manner possible.
It’s also important to shop around and compare prices when looking for an attorney or financial advisor to help you establish an asset protection trust Different professionals may have different fee structures or billing practices, so it’s worth taking the time to request quotes from multiple providers before making a decision Remember that the cost of setting up an asset protection trust is an investment in the long-term protection of your assets, so it’s important to find a provider who offers a good balance of cost and expertise.
